Turf Drainage & Base Prep — What to Know

Our turf drainage and base prep process is the backbone of every successful artificial turf installation in Modoc. We begin with meticulous excavation, removing existing grass and often a layer of that stubborn Georgia clay turf base. This step is crucial for establishing the proper grade, ensuring water flows away from your property, not towards it. Next, we install a robust sub-base, typically consisting of crushed aggregate. This material is rigorously compacted in layers to create an incredibly stable, permeable foundation that won't shift or settle over time. Compaction is key here – it prevents future undulations in your turf. For pet turf drainage, we often incorporate additional measures, such as enhanced drainage layers or infill systems that proactively move liquids through the turf and base, preventing odors and standing water. Finally, a fine layer of decomposed granite or similar material is spread and precision-graded, providing the perfectly smooth and level surface required before the turf itself is laid. This multi-layered approach guarantees optimal water permeability, preventing puddling even during our heaviest summer downpours, and ensures your artificial turf remains beautiful and functional for decades to come, unaffected by the seasonal challenges unique to Modoc.

Frequently Asked Questions

How does Modoc's red clay impact artificial turf drainage?

Modoc's dense red clay turf base can impede natural drainage. We counteract this by excavating, installing a deep, permeable aggregate base, and ensuring proper grading so water flows efficiently through and off your turf system, preventing pooling.

Is special pet turf drainage necessary in Modoc's humid climate?

Absolutely. Our humid climate can exacerbate odors if pet waste isn't properly drained. We utilize specialized infills and superior sub-base designs to ensure rapid liquid drainage, keeping your Modoc pet turf fresh and hygienic.

What's the typical timeline for turf base prep in Modoc?

The timeline for base prep in Modoc depends on the project size and existing conditions. For an average backyard, base preparation might take 1-3 days, ensuring proper excavation, material delivery, and thorough compaction for a lasting foundation.

Will heavy McCormick County thunderstorms affect my turf's drainage?

Our proper installation and meticulously designed turf drainage systems are built to handle McCormick County's heaviest thunderstorms. We ensure your base promotes rapid water percolation and runoff, preventing standing water even during intense downpours.
